Petri nets; net transformation; graph transformation; visual editor reconfigurable object net; Eclipse; GEF
Résumé :
[en] The main idea behind Reconfigurable Object Nets (RONs) is the integration of transition firing and rule-based net structure transformation of place/transition nets during system simulation. RONs are high-level nets with two types of tokens: object nets (place/transition nets) and net transformation rules (a dedicated type of graph transformation rules). Firing of high-level transitions may involve firing of object net transitions, transporting object net tokens through the high-level net, and applying net transformation rules to object nets. Net transformations include net modifications such as merging or splitting of object nets, and net refinement. This approach increases the expressiveness of Petri nets and is especially suited to model mobile distributed processes. The paper presents a visual editor for RONs which has been developed in a student project at TU Berlin in summer 2007. The visual editor itself has been realized as a plug-in for ECLIPSE using the ECLIPSE Modeling Framework (EMF) and Graphical Editor Framework (GEF) plug-ins.
Disciplines :
Sciences informatiques
Auteur, co-auteur :
Biermann, Enrico
Ermel, Claudia
HERMANN, Frank ; University of Luxembourg > Interdisciplinary Centre for Security, Reliability and Trust (SNT)
Tony, Modica
Langue du document :
Anglais
Titre :
A Visual Editor for Reconfigurable Object Nets based on the ECLIPSE Graphical Editor Framework
Date de publication/diffusion :
2007
Nom de la manifestation :
Workshop on Algorithms and Tools for Petri Nets (AWPN'07)
Date de la manifestation :
2007
Titre de l'ouvrage principal :
Proc. 14th Workshop on Algorithms and Tools for Petri Nets (AWPN'07)
Editeur scientifique :
Juhas, G.
Desel, J.
Maison d'édition :
GI Special Interest Group on Petri Nets and Related System Models